
On Monday, July 8, two members of the Robeson Community College Board of Trustees were re-appointed and sworn in during the bi-monthly meeting.
Paul McDowell begins his 3rd term serving on the RCC Board and for Tito Massol, this will be his 2nd term as a Trustee.
Courtney Jacobs, Executive Assistant to the President and the Board of Trustees, and a registered notary public for the State of North Carolina, administered the oath of office to the two trustees.
